Home | History | Annotate | Download | only in c-index-test

Lines Matching defs:FileName

71     free((char *)unsaved_files[i].Filename);
104 char *filename;
152 filename = (char *)malloc(filename_len + 1);
153 memcpy(filename, arg_string, filename_len);
154 filename[filename_len] = 0;
155 unsaved->Filename = filename;
950 on failure. If successful, the pointer *filename will contain newly-allocated
952 int parse_file_line_column(const char *input, char **filename, unsigned *line,
963 fprintf(stderr, "could not parse filename
966 fprintf(stderr, "could not parse filename:line:column in '%s'\n", input);
1006 *filename = (char*)malloc(last_colon - input + 1);
1007 memcpy(*filename, input, last_colon - input);
1008 (*filename)[last_colon - input] = 0;
1256 char *filename = 0;
1276 if ((errorCode = parse_file_line_column(input, &filename, &line, &column,
1303 results = clang_codeCompleteAt(TU, filename, line, column,
1370 free(filename);
1378 char *filename;
1405 if ((errorCode = parse_file_line_column(input, &Locations[Loc].filename,
1448 CXFile file = clang_getFile(TU, Locations[Loc].filename);
1492 free(Locations[Loc].filename);
1538 if ((errorCode = parse_file_line_column(input, &Locations[Loc].filename,
1581 CXFile file = clang_getFile(TU, Locations[Loc].filename);
1597 free(Locations[Loc].filename);
1633 CXString filename = clang_getFileName((CXFile)file);
1634 printf("%s", clang_getCString(filename));
1635 clang_disposeString(filename);
1640 CXString filename;
1656 filename = clang_getFileName((CXFile)file);
1657 cname = clang_getCString(filename);
1662 clang_disposeString(filename);
1847 CXString filename;
1852 filename = clang_getFileName(file);
1853 index_data->main_filename = clang_getCString(filename);
1854 clang_disposeString(filename);
1871 printf(" | name: \"%s\"", info->filename);
2130 char *filename = 0;
2147 if ((errorCode = parse_file_line_column(input, &filename, &line, &column,
2164 free(filename);
2189 file = clang_getFile(TU, filename);
2191 fprintf(stderr, "file %s is not in this translation unit\n", filename);
2198 fprintf(stderr, "invalid source location %s:%d:%d\n", filename, line,
2206 fprintf(stderr, "invalid source location %s:%d:%d\n", filename,
2261 free(filename);
2440 int write_pch_file(const char *filename, int argc, const char *argv[]) {
2467 switch (clang_saveTranslationUnit(TU, filename,
2474 filename);
2480 filename);
2486 fprintf(stderr, "Unable to write PCH file %s: unknown error \n", filename);
2535 CXString FileName;
2539 FileName = clang_getFileName(File);
2541 fprintf(stderr, "%s:%d:%d", clang_getCString(FileName), line, column);
2542 clang_disposeString(FileName);
2592 CXString FileName, DiagSpelling, DiagOption, DiagCat;
2599 FileName = clang_getFileName(File);
2605 clang_getCString(FileName),
2631 clang_disposeString(FileName);
2637 static int read_diagnostics(const char *filename) {
2642 Diags = clang_loadDiagnostics(filename, &error, &errorString);